Description and Introduction

0.7 A Dual H-Bridge Motor Driver with 3.0 V/5.0 V Compatible Logic I/O The **MPC17529EVEL** is a highly efficient, integrated motor driver designed for precision control in a variety of applications. This electronic component combines advanced power management with robust performance, making it suitable for driving brushed DC motors, stepper motors, and other electromechanical systems.  

Engineered for reliability, the MPC17529EVEL features a compact form factor and low-power operation, ensuring optimal efficiency in space-constrained designs. Its built-in protection mechanisms—such as overcurrent, overtemperature, and undervoltage lockout—enhance system durability by safeguarding against common electrical faults.  

With a versatile input voltage range and configurable control interfaces, this driver supports seamless integration into industrial automation, robotics, automotive systems, and consumer electronics. The device’s PWM (Pulse-Width Modulation) capability allows for precise speed and torque adjustments, while its low RDS(on) MOSFETs minimize power dissipation, improving thermal performance.  

The MPC17529EVEL is designed to simplify motor control implementation, reducing the need for external components and streamlining PCB layouts. Its compatibility with microcontrollers and logic-level signals ensures straightforward interfacing with modern control systems.
